Denbigh Castle

A commanding medieval fortress built by Edward I in the late 13th century, perched above Denbigh with panoramic views over the Vale of Clwyd and the Clwydian Range. Step through the triple‑towered gatehouse to encounter dramatic re-enactments of drawbridge and portcullis mechanics. Stroll around largely intact medieval town walls stretching over 1 km, and visit the ruins of St Hilary’s Chapel and the Burgess Gate nearby.

Llyn Brenig Reservoir & Osprey Project

A lakeside sanctuary surrounded by woodlands and moorland, home to nesting ospreys that can be observed via hides or livestreams during season. Visitors praise paddleboarding and guided wildlife watching sessions from the visitor centre.

Rhuddlan Castle

A majestic Norman ruin on the banks of the River Clwyd, Rhuddlan Castle offers a more compact but atmospheric castle experience. Established in the 13th century with rich Norman heritage and scenic riverbank walks.

Prestatyn Sand Dunes (Gronant)

Just 20 minutes away, this designated nature reserve boasts golden dunes, coastal paths, and rare plant and bird species. Ideal for peaceful walks or wildlife spotting at the edge of the Irish Sea coast.

Chester

Within a 30-minute drive, the historic city of Chester awaits — a beautifully preserved Roman and Georgian city offering upscale shopping in rows of timber‑framed arcades, fine dining, and attractions like city walls, Chester Cathedral, and the amphitheatre.
